Automatización QA

Nuestra solución de automatización QA consiste en la implementación de herramientas y software especializados, para automatizar las pruebas de calidad en productos o aplicaciones de software. Además, ofrecemos pruebas de carga adicionales en nuestra solución de automatización QA, garantizando que las aplicaciones puedan manejar el tráfico y la demanda del mundo real.

Utilizamos herramientas especializadas para simular cargas de usuarios y medir el rendimiento del sistema en términos de tiempos de respuesta y utilización de recursos.

Parasoft Logo
Selenium Logo
ASPM

Modelo de Automatización Continuo con IA

Nuestro Modelo de Automatización Continuo con Inteligencia Artificial se destaca por integrar desarrollos pioneros, orientados hacia un enfoque de "shift left" en el proceso de testing dentro del desarrollo del Software. Esta metodología ágil logra reducir los tiempos de automatización en un 60% y la mantención en un 40%, maximizando la eficiencia y la calidad del Software.

Características destacadas:

  • Eficiencia en Automatización y Reutilización

    Implementamos pruebas automatizadas QA y de performance, con la menor intervención humana posible. De esta manera, reutilizamos scripts de pruebas funcionales en pruebas no funcionales, especialmente en las pruebas de carga y performance.


  • Potenciación de Pruebas con Inteligencia Artificial:

    Aseguramos una mayor cobertura y precisión, llevando adelante mejores resultados.


  • Pruebas de Integración Robustas

    Realizamos pruebas de integración hacia APIs, mejorando la calidad y la eficiencia del proceso de testing.


  • Optimización de Tiempo y Recursos

    Logramos realizar pruebas de carga efectivas con menor inversión de tiempo y recursos, lo que conduce a un testing más ágil y robusto.

ASPM

Beneficios Clave:

Aceleración

Logramos una aceleración significativa del proceso de testing, conllevando una notable reducción en los tiempos y costos de automatización y mantenimiento.

Calidad y Cobertura

Mejora en la calidad y cobertura de las pruebas, tanto funcionales como no funcionales.

Reducción

Reducimos los tiempos de desarrollo y aumentamos en la eficiencia operativa.

Alineación

Logramos alinear las necesidades de agilidad y adaptabilidad en el cambiante mundo de la tecnología de la información, para obtener una mejor solución con eficiencia.

Este modelo avanzado no solo representa una evolución en cuanto a la eficiencia y efectividad en el testing de Software, sino que también está diseñado para satisfacer las demandas de un entorno tecnológico en constante evolución.

Servicio API Testing

El servicio de API testing es un complemento de nuestro servicio de Pruebas QA. Acompaña en el proceso de automatización mediante el uso de una plataforma intuitiva, para facilitar y mejorar la experiencia de nuestros clientes.

Parasoft soatest es una herramienta integral de pruebas de software, que combina funciones de pruebas de servicio, pruebas de carga y rendimiento. Permite automatizar la prueba de diversos servicios web, REST, JSON, SOAP, JMS, AMQP, FTP, bases de datos, entre otros.

También ofrece capacidades de pruebas de carga y rendimiento con LOADTest para evaluar el rendimiento bajo, cargas pesadas y picos de tráfico. Además, incluye funciones avanzadas de análisis y generación de informes, integración con herramientas de automatización de pruebas existentes y una interfaz fácil de usar.

Caracteristicas
caracteristica
Automatización de pruebas

Los equipos pueden crear scripts de pruebas utilizando una interfaz gráfica de usuario (GUI) fácil de usar o una API.payoff interfaces without it.

caracteristica
Cobertura de pruebas

Ofrece una cobertura completa de pruebas de servicios, incluyendo pruebas de extremo a extremo, pruebas de integración y pruebas unitarias.

caracteristica
Pruebas funcionales

Permite probar la funcionalidad de los servicios web mediante la verificación de las respuestas de los servicios frente a los requisitos definidos.

caracteristica
Pruebas de carga y rendimiento

LoadTest es una extensión de SOAtest, que ofrece pruebas de carga y rendimiento para los servicios REST y SOAP. Los equipos pueden crear escenarios de carga realistas y personalizados para probar sus servicios en condiciones de carga pesada y estrés.

caracteristica
Integración con SOAtest

LoadTest se integra con SOAtest para proporcionar una solución integral de pruebas de rendimiento. Permite usar la misma interfaz de usuario y scripts de pruebas que utilizan para las pruebas de servicios.

caracteristica
Monitoreo en tiempo real

LoadTest proporciona análisis de rendimiento en tiempo real para que los equipos puedan identificar cuellos de botella y problemas de rendimiento mientras se ejecutan las pruebas.

Proceso

¿Cómo funciona nuestra solución?

Análisis de requerimientos
En nuestra solución de automatización de pruebas QA, nuestros consultores se integran en los procesos de desarrollo de software para comprender el negocio y las necesidades del cliente.
Automatización
Utilizan las herramientas para crear pruebas automatizadas precisas y consistentes, identificar errores y fallas en el software de manera temprana.
Pruebas de regresión
Despliegan las pruebas automatizadas en herramientas de CI/CD, para un despliegue y entrega de valor continuo. Así, el software se actualiza de manera constante.
Pruebas de carga
Adicionalmente, ofrecemos pruebas de carga para garantizar que el software funcione correctamente bajo cargas máximas de usuarios. Nuestro equipo utiliza herramientas especializadas para simular el tráfico y la carga del usuario en el software, identificando problemas de rendimiento y capacidad antes de que se presenten problemas en la producción.
Pruebas de carga continuas
Nuestras pruebas de carga también son desplegadas en herramientas de CI/CD para garantizar que el software pueda manejar la carga y el tráfico de manera constante y continua.
Beneficios

¿Por qué elegir Nuestra solución?

Permite identificar errores y fallas en el software de manera temprana, y corregirlos antes del lanzamiento del producto final.

Reduce los costos y tiempos de desarrollo al minimizar el tiempo y esfuerzo requerido para realizar pruebas manuales. Esto permite que el equipo de desarrollo se centre en otras tareas y acelere el proceso de desarrollo.

La realización de pruebas de manera constante y continua a través de herramientas de CI/CD garantiza que el software se actualice y funcione correctamente en todo momento.

La automatización de las pruebas QA permite una mayor eficiencia y consistencia en la realización de las pruebas. Esto garantiza que las pruebas se realicen de manera precisa y consistente en todo momento.

La identificación temprana de problemas de rendimiento y capacidad en el software permite a los desarrolladores corregirlos antes de que sean un problema en producción.

Las pruebas de carga garantizan que el software pueda manejar cargas máximas de usuarios, lo que mejora la experiencia del usuario al garantizar que el software pueda responder de manera rápida y eficiente.

Ahorra tiempo y esfuerzo en el proceso de desarrollo, y reduce los costos en la corrección de problemas en un entorno de producción. De esta manera se logra acelerar el proceso de desarrollo y mejorar la calidad del producto final.

Desarrolladores

Simula cargas y mide el rendimiento de tu sistema con nuestras Solución de pruebas QA